Amaray retains Iso9001:2008 accreditation.

The ISO 9001:2008 standard was introduced to increase customer satisfaction through continuous improvements. It specifies requirements for a quality management system where an organisation needs to demonstrate its ability to consistently provide product that meets customer and regulatory requirements.

The audit evaluated Amaray’s processes and procedures in relation to new product introduction, technical development, supply chain manufacturing and distribution.

Jamie Tinsley, Managing Director of Amaray Europe says “Retaining the accreditation is vitally important for both us and our customers. Working closely with leading consumer brands, we are constantly developing and collaborating on new plastic products. They put their trust in us. In addition, the arrival of their existing production moulds transferred from their site to ours in Corby is helping to build deeper relationships. This accreditation is just one, from a number of commitments we’ve made to make good things better.”

Amaray, based in Corby, Northamptonshire offers extensive services within rigid plastic packaging including; product design, concept development, supported with injection moulding production and in-line decoration.
